I like taking my analog camera with me when I'm walking in the city and taking pictures of my friends because printed pictures have a special vibe.
There are a few places where you can buy films for your camera, but this one is my favourite because it is not just a shop, it is a community where you can also buy cameras for your collection, films and much more.
So, if you are fan of analog photography or collecting old school cameras, this place is definitely worth visiting. You can buy film for your analog camera there and the assistants from the shop will help you insert it into the camera. It's also a great place to print your pictures because the people who work there are big fans of this kind of art!
From time to time they organize their own events: networking or educational, where you can meet new people or exchange knowledge.
One more option is to rent a studio there and hold your own event or photoshoot!
